13th International Folklore Festival Plzeň
10 to 14 June, 2009, Plzeň (Pilsen)
Since its first year in 1997, the Plzeň festival has been a meeting place for lovers of folklore and folk art. It welcomes annually about twenty adult and children´s folk ensembles from the Czech Republic and abroad, including guests from exotic countries. The various festival events take place in the historical city center in the pleasant environment of Kopecký Gardens. Hundreds of performers in colorful folk costumes create an unrepeatable atmosphere with their music, dancing, and singing.
Founded in 1295, Plzeň has been a natural economic and cultural center of West Bohemia. Its best known monuments include St Bartholomew Cathedral, the Renaissance town hall, and the old synagogue. Much-sought-for is the world-known Plzeň´s brewery Plzeňský Prazdroj (Pilsner Urquell).
